Lines Matching refs:testdata
3283 struct bom_testdata *const testdata in external_bom_checker() local
3285 const char *const external = testdata->external; in external_bom_checker()
3286 const int split = testdata->split; in external_bom_checker()
3287 testdata->nested_callback_happened = XML_TRUE; in external_bom_checker()
3319 struct bom_testdata testdata; in START_TEST() local
3320 testdata.external = external; in START_TEST()
3321 testdata.split = split; in START_TEST()
3322 testdata.nested_callback_happened = XML_FALSE; in START_TEST()
3330 XML_SetUserData(parser, &testdata); in START_TEST()
3334 if (! testdata.nested_callback_happened) { in START_TEST()
5478 struct element_decl_data *testdata = (struct element_decl_data *)userData; in element_decl_counter() local
5479 testdata->count += 1; in element_decl_counter()
5480 XML_FreeContentModel(testdata->parser, model); in element_decl_counter()
5507 struct element_decl_data testdata; in external_inherited_parser() local
5508 testdata.parser = parser; in external_inherited_parser()
5509 testdata.count = 0; in external_inherited_parser()
5510 XML_SetUserData(parser, &testdata); in external_inherited_parser()
5519 assert_true(testdata.count == 1); // first element should be done in external_inherited_parser()
5526 assert_true(testdata.count == 1); // still just the first one in external_inherited_parser()
5535 assert_true(testdata.count == 1); // *still* just the first one in external_inherited_parser()
5546 assert_true(testdata.count == 1); // or the test is incorrect in external_inherited_parser()
5555 assert_true(testdata.count == 2); // the big token should be done in external_inherited_parser()
5562 assert_true(testdata.count == 3); // after isFinal=XML_TRUE, all must be done in external_inherited_parser()